Police & Fire Committee Public Works Committee May 23, 2024, Minutes Present: Buchanan, Kamlitz, Steele, Heinrich, Ryan, Hellekson, Blackmore, Dillman, Dixon, Edinger, Lipetzky, Michel, O’Neill, Reuther, Rowell, Stroh, and Sveum. Absent: Schloegel. POLICE & FIRE COMMITTEE Mayor Heinrich convened the meeting at 4:00 p.m. City Engineer Dillman provided an update on the Southside Fire Station Roof Improvements. City Attorney Ryan and Fire Chief Reuther discussed the potential need for a burn restriction ordinance. Buchanan seated himself. Chair Buchanan adjourned the meeting at 4:03 p.m. PUBLIC WORKS COMMITTEE Chair Steele convened the meeting at 4:03 p.m. Public Works Director Michel proposed some changes to the current street closure application and policy. Buchanan moved to table this matter for further study. Seconded by Heinrich. Unanimous aye vote. Carried. Heinrich moved to recommend the City Council approve to advertise for bids for the sale of a 2000 Sterling Leach Packer Body and a 2010 Rear-Load Freightliner. Seconded by Kamlitz. Public Works Director Michel provided information. Unanimous aye vote. Carried. Heinrich moved to direct the City Administrator, Public Works Director, and City Attorney to meet with Mr. Friebel, Recycling Center of North Dakota, LLC, regarding the contract and any changes that might be made and report to the committee. Seconded by Kamlitz. Unanimous aye vote. Carried. Kamlitz moved to recommend the City Council approve introducing the first reading of the Pretreatment Ordinance. Seconded by Heinrich. Public Works Director Michel, City Attorney Ryan, and City Engineer Dillman provided information. Unanimous aye vote. Carried. Heinrich moved to recommend the City Council approve the advertisement for bids for the purchase of One (1) Front End Loader for the Solid Waste Department. Seconded by Kamlitz. Unanimous aye vote. Carried. Heinrich moved to forward, without recommendation, to the City Council meeting June 3, 2024, the bids for the Public Works Department Excavator. Seconded by Kamlitz. City Attorney Ryan provided information. Unanimous aye vote. Carried. Heinrich moved to forward, without recommendation, to the City Council meeting June 3, 2024, the quotes for the trailer to haul the excavator. Seconded by Kamlitz. Public Works Director Michel provided information. Unanimous aye vote. Carried. INFORMATIONAL: May 30, 2024, bid opening for McElroy Park Force Main Relocation project # 24-72. City Engineer Dillman reviewed the project updates. Sanitation Foreman O’Neill provided a department update and shared City Wide Cleanup results. Chair Steele adjourned the meeting at 4:57 p.m. Sarah Hellekson, City Administrator
